Nurtured by nature

South African conservationist Andrew Muir is harnessing the healing powers of nature to help young people orphaned by HIV/Aids become independent citizens.

"…the vulnerability of these orphans has generally been 18 years in the making and will need something pretty intense and all-embracing to turn it around!

Muir’s Umzi Wethu programme provides vulnerable but motivated youths with vocational training and jobs in the burgeoning ecotourism industry, while immersing them in their country’s rich natural heritage.

Latest Update

Muir’s project grows faster than imagined

From a staff of two five years ago, Umzi Wethu now has 14 full-time staff, two academies — with a third due to open in mid-2011 — and 111 graduates in full-time jobs
